PUSH Festival Assistant Internship

We’re excited to announce our latest paid Internship role, supporting our annual PUSH Festival.

This is a great opportunity for someone age 18+ who is interested in exploring a creative career, with a particular interest in the planning and delivery of a cross-art form festival. This Internship aims to give an insight into the work of HOME across all art forms and teams, as well as into the stages of preparing and delivering a busy festival.

PUSH 2018 will take place from Fri 12 – Sat 27 January 2018. Across the two weeks HOME will be entirely dedicated to presenting inspiring, creative experiences fresh from the North West. Have a look at the PUSH Festival Guide.

We’re keen to hear from people who are looking for an entry level role to explore a career in the creative industries. You will need to have an interest in culture and be keen to explore a career in the arts or in event production. You’ll also need to be interested in finding out more about the work HOME creates and presents.

Salary: £7.57 per hour
Total hours of contract: 112
Starting: Week Commencing 4 December 2017
Ending: Week Commencing 29 January 2018
